In ORIGIN OF CHRISTIANITY and JUDAISM, Manfred Davidmann proves what Jesus really taught: The social laws of the Torah have to be followed. These social laws guarantee equality, social justice and security, and a good life for all members of the community. These laws protect people from exploitation, oppression and enslavement through need. Early Christians, being mostly Jews, followed these laws.

Manfred Davidmann then proves how these essential social laws of the Torah were bypassed and ceased to be observed, in Judaism and in Christianity at the same time.

He describes and proves how Paul changed what Jesus had taught, how Paul's ideology serves the establishment instead of the people, and how this became Christianity's official doctrine. On the other hand Manfred Davidmann shows that the Talmud (especially the Mishnah) tells how Hillel changed Judaism in the same way, to what it is today.

The Dead Sea Scrolls, within the context of the findings reported here, become much more meaningful. In turn, the knowledge gained from them is part of the pattern of events recorded here for the first time.
What you find here is scientific analysis of facts established by the methods of biblical archaeology.

Outstanding are the sections on Paul and the Gospels: Manfred Davidmann shows that Paul's ideology was first opposed and that successive gospel writers then changed the record in Paul's favour, and how they did it.

Personally, I have long noticed an appprent contradiction between Jesus and Paul re: how one gets saved. Jesus emphasizes works and Paul emphasizes faith. Everyone here will say that there is no contradiction, but there is a definite difference in emphasis.

Yes, IMO there absolutely is. The only way to avoid this contradiction, IMO, is to ignore the three Synoptic gospels and pretend that John is the only one when - when, in fact, John's Jesus is entirely different from the Jesus of the Synoptics, John's christology is entirely different from that of the Synoptics, and John's gospel is riddled with mysterious sayings that scholars are in pretty solid agreement Jesus never said. Although Paul's letters generally predate the gospels, you have to wonder how he arrived at his christology and whether Jesus himself would have been completely bewildered by it.
